Race Car Driver Liam Lawson Set to Compete in Singapore Grand Prix, Sporting Helmet Crafted by Christchurch Father
In an exciting turn of events, a father-of-three from Christchurch, New Zealand, named Ian Ebbs, has won a nationwide helmet design competition held by Formula 1 star Liam Lawson. The competition invited New Zealanders to submit original designs for Lawson's helmet, and Ebbs' bold, energetic, and uniquely Kiwi design stood out from over 500 entries.
The winning design features a fun, cartoon-like kiwi bird donning a pink backwards cap while driving a golf cart. This whimsical image encapsulates Lawson's love for New Zealand, golf, and his personal journey, as Ebbs took inspiration from Pixar's Lightning McQueen but tailored it to Lawson's newfound love for golf.
Ebbs, a lifelong Formula 1 fan, came up with the idea to enter the competition during a visit to a dairy with his son. His passion for the sport, passed down to his family, shines through in his design. The design includes elements like ferns, rolling hills, clouds, kiwi fruit, and the shape of New Zealand, all symbolising the beauty of the country.
Lawson personally reviewed every submission for the competition and expressed gratitude to all participants. He mentioned the difficulty in choosing a single winner but was drawn to Ebbs' design for its unique blend of fun, energy, and Kiwi spirit.
As part of his prize, Ian Ebbs will travel to Singapore with his 8-year-old son Michael to deliver the custom-designed helmet to Lawson in person ahead of the race weekend in October. This will be a memorable experience for both father and son, as they share their passion for Formula 1 with the rising star.
Lawson, who has chosen a fan-designed helmet for the Singapore Grand Prix this October, expressed his excitement about the winning design, saying, "Ian's design perfectly represents my love for New Zealand and my newfound love for golf. I can't wait to wear it on the track."
The main colours of the design are pink, blue, and white, which are colours Lawson often uses on his helmets. This continuity between the old and the new designs adds a personal touch to the helmet, making it truly unique.
In an interview, Ebbs shared his feelings about winning the competition, saying, "It's an absolute dream come true. I've been a Formula 1 fan all my life, and to have my design chosen by Liam Lawson is just amazing. I can't wait to travel to Singapore with my son and meet Liam in person."
